Position Summary:

The Welding Inspection Supervisor is responsible for conducting visual and non-destructive examinations of welded materials and structures to ensure compliance with applicable codes, standards, and client specifications, including ISO 17025 requirements. The role involves inspection, accurate documentation, supervision of inspection activities, and interpretation of welding procedures and technical drawings within an accredited laboratory environment. The position contributes to maintaining quality, safety, and integrity in materials testing services.

Responsibilities:

  • Conduct visual welding inspections before, during, and after welding operations, including procedure and welder qualification tests
  • Perform and interpret NDT methods such as ultrasonic testing (UT), magnetic particle testing (MT), and dye penetrant testing (PT)
  • Verify weld joint preparation, fit-up, and welding parameters against approved WPS
  • Evaluate weld quality for defects and compliance with acceptance criteria
  • Deliver welded samples to NDT providers and laboratories for testing
  • Supervise welding inspectors, manage scheduling, review reports, and train junior staff
  • Interpret radiographic testing (RT) films
  • Maintain detailed inspection records, reports, and test documentation
  • Prepare non-conformance reports (NCRs) for defects and deviations
  • Ensure compliance with ISO 17025 and internal quality procedures
  • Generate and submit inspection reports to clients and stakeholders
  • Interpret welding codes and standards (ASME, AWS, API, ISO, Aramco)
  • Apply WPS and PQR requirements in inspection activities
  • Stay updated with industry best practices and technologies
  • Read and interpret engineering drawings
  • Communicate inspection findings and project updates to clients
  • Address client queries and resolve technical issues
  • Follow all safety requirements and use appropriate PPE

Qualifications:

  • Diploma or Bachelor’s degree in Welding Engineering, Materials Engineering, or related field (preferred)
  • CSWIP 3.1 Welding Inspector certification
  • NDT Level II certifications in VT, UT, MT, and PT (ASNT, PCN, or equivalent)
  • Strong knowledge of welding processes, metallurgy, and NDT techniques
  • Proficiency in welding codes and standards (ASME, AWS, API, ISO)
  • Strong communication and documentation skills
  • Ability to work independently and in a team
  • Proficiency in inspection equipment and software
  • Knowledge of ISO 17025 requirements

Requirements:

  • Minimum 7–10 years of experience in welding inspection
  • Minimum 3–5 years of experience as a welding supervisor/manager for PQR/WQT qualification testing
  • Valid driver’s license
